Volume 3, Book 31, Number 168:
Narrated Anas bin Malik:
We used to travel with the Prophet and neither did the fasting persons criticize those who were
not fasting, nor did those who were not fasting criticize the fasting ones.
Volume 3, Book 31, Number 146:
Narrated Anas bin Malik:
The Prophet said, “Take Suhur as there is a blessing in it.”

Volume 3, Book 29, Number 72:
Narrated Anas bin Malik:
Allah’s Apostle entered Mecca in the year of its Conquest wearing an Arabian helmet on his head
and when the Prophet took it off, a person came and said, “Ibn Khatal is holding the covering of the
Ka’ba (taking refuge in the Ka’ba).” The Prophet said, “Kill him.”
Volume 2, Book 26, Number 811:
Narrated Anas bin Malik:
The Prophet offered the Zuhr, ‘Asr, Maghrib and the ‘Isha’ prayers and slept for a while at a place
called Al-Mahassab and then rode to the Ka’ba and performed Tawaf round it .
Volume 2, Book 26, Number 817:
Narrated Anas bin Malik:
The Prophet offered the Zuhr, ‘Asr, Maghrib and ‘Isha’ prayers and slept for a while at a place
called Al-Mahassab and then he rode towards the Ka’ba and performed Tawaf (al-Wada’).
Volume 2, Book 26, Number 773:
Narrated Anas bin Malik:
The Prophet (p.b.u.h) offered four Rakat of Zuhr prayer at Medina and two Rakat of ‘Asr prayer at
Dhul-Hulaifa. Narrated Aiyub: “A man said: Anas said, “Then he (the Prophet passed the night there
till dawn and then he offered the morning (Fajr) prayer, and mounted his Mount and when it ar –
rived at Al-Baida’ he assumed Ihram for both ‘Umra and Hajj.”
Volume 2, Book 26, Number 629:
Narrated Anas bin Malik:
Ali came to the Prophet (p.b.u.h) from Yemen (to Mecca). The Prophet asked Ali, “With what in –
tention have you assumed Ihram?” Ali replied, “I have assumed Ihram with the same intention as that
of the Prophet.” The Prophet said, “If I had not the Hadi with me I would have finished the Ihram.”
Muhammad bin Bakr narrated extra from Ibn Juraij, “The Prophet said to Ali, “With what intention
have you assumed the Ihram, O Ali?” He replied, “With the same (intention) as that of the Prophet.”
The Prophet said, “Have a Hadi and keep your Ihram as it is.”
